Bitcoin vs. Gold: The Ultimate Asset Allocation Debate
The ongoing controversy surrounding Bitcoin and gold as leading holdings has captivated investors and economists alike. Proponents of Bitcoin champion its innovative nature, potential for exponential growth, and limited supply. On the other hand, gold has long been revered as a safe haven against inflation. Choosing between these two contrasting investments requires careful consideration of individual objectives and investment horizon.
One key separation lies in their respective price fluctuations. Bitcoin is notorious for its wild price volatility, while gold typically exhibits more stable movements. This inherent risk associated with Bitcoin appeals some investors seeking high profits, while others prefer the relative predictability offered by gold.
Furthermore, Bitcoin's digital nature presents both opportunities and risks. Its open-source system enhances verifiability, but also raises confidentiality concerns. Gold, on the other hand, is a tangible asset with an established legacy as a store of value.
- Ultimately, the "better" option between Bitcoin and gold depends on individual circumstances.
- Strategic planning often involves investing a portion of your portfolio to both assets, taking advantage of their respective positive attributes and mitigating potential vulnerabilities.

Exploring the World of Altcoins
Bitcoin may be the pioneer, but the copyright landscape features a vast and ever-evolving ecosystem of alternative coins. These altcoins, as they are commonly known, offer trading or stock a wide range of functionalities, aiming to address various aspects of the financial system. From privacy-focused coins like Monero to decentralized applications built on platforms like Ethereum, the possibilities are truly infinite. Uncovering into this realm allows you to discover innovative solutions and grasp the true potential of blockchain technology beyond Bitcoin's dominance.
- Absolutely, altcoins present a fascinating opportunity for investors seeking diversification and exposure to cutting-edge advancements in the copyright space.
- However, it is crucial to conduct thorough research and evaluate the risks associated with each individual coin before making any investment decisions.
